Healthcare Jobs in France – Complete Guide (2026)

France is one of the top countries in Europe with a world-class healthcare system. Because of its strong medical infrastructure and aging population, there is a growing demand for healthcare professionals. This creates good opportunities for both local and international candidates who want to build a career in the medical field.

Why Choose France for Healthcare Jobs?

France offers a well-structured and government-supported healthcare system. Hospitals, clinics, and care centers are always in need of skilled staff. Due to staff shortages in some areas, foreign healthcare workers are increasingly being considered for roles.

In-Demand Healthcare Jobs in France

1. Doctors

  • General Practitioners (GPs)
  • Specialists (Cardiology, Neurology, etc.)
    Doctors are highly in demand, especially in rural areas, but licensing requirements are strict.

2. Nurses

  • Registered Nurses
  • ICU and emergency nurses
    Nursing is one of the most in-demand professions in France.

3. Care Assistants

  • Elderly care workers
  • Patient support staff
    This is a good entry-level option with relatively easier requirements.

4. Pharmacists

  • Hospital pharmacists
  • Retail pharmacy roles

5. Medical Technicians

  • Lab technicians
  • Radiology staff

Requirements to Work in France

To work in the French healthcare sector, you must meet certain requirements:

Qualification Recognition

Your degree must be recognized in France. This process is known as “equivalence.”

French Language Skills

You typically need at least B1 or B2 level French, as communication with patients is essential.

Professional Licensing

Doctors and nurses must register with relevant French medical authorities before working.

Work Experience

Some roles, especially specialized ones, require prior experience.

Salary Expectations

Healthcare salaries in France are competitive:

  • Doctors: €4,000 – €10,000+ per month
  • Nurses: €2,000 – €3,500 per month
  • Care Assistants: €1,500 – €2,200 per month
  • Pharmacists: €3,000 – €5,000 per month

Visa Sponsorship Options

Some hospitals and healthcare institutions in France offer visa sponsorship, particularly for:

  • Nurses
  • Caregivers
  • Experienced doctors

Highly skilled professionals may also apply for the EU Blue Card.

Benefits of Working in France

  • Access to a high-quality healthcare system
  • Paid annual leave (25+ days)
  • Strong work-life balance
  • Opportunity to apply for permanent residency

Challenges to Consider

  • Learning French can take time
  • Degree recognition can be a lengthy process
  • Some roles have high competition
